II श्रीराम जय राम जय जय राम II
माझे चित्त तुझे पायी I
राहे ऐसे करी कांही I
धरोनिया बाही I
भव हा तारी दातारा II
चतुरा तू शिरोमणी I
गुणलावण्याची खाणी I
मुगुट सकळां मणि I
धन्य तूंचि विठोबा II
करी या तिमिराचा नाश I
उदय होऊनि प्रकाश I
तोंडी आशापाश् I
करी वास हृदयी II
पाहे गुंतलो नेणतां I
माझी असो तुम्हां चिंता I
तुका ठेवी माथा I
पायीं आतां राखावे II
"In this composition Sant Tukaram Maharaj says, O'Lord do something so that my attention remains riveted at Your Feet.
He says, become my helmsman O'Lord and carry me across the sea of repeated sufferings once and for all.
He says, You are the zenith of Wisdom O'Lord Vithoba, the Greater than the Greatest and Higher than the Highest. The noblest of all vitues You are O'Lord , for Your Sublime beauty neither fades nor is lost in the withering touch of years.
He says, let You dwell in my heart O'Lord and not the attachment to material pleasures and let the shining light of Your Divine Wisdom dispel the darkness of my ignorance.
Summing up Sant Tukaram Maharaj says, I fall at Your Feet O'Lord and implore You earnestly to save me from getting drowned in the abyss of ignorance, the root cause of all sufferings."
